Lalibela to Produce 1.2 Mln tn of Cement a Year

Details
Category: Manufacturing

Production to start in 2014

Lalibela Cement Factory, which is currently selling shares, is planning to start construction in June 2012 in Dejen, on 3,000 hectares of land.

The factory will produce 1.2 million tonnes of Ordinary Portland Cement and Portland Pozzolana Cement annually when it begins fully fledged production in 2014.

Leaders Start Negotiation for Free Trade Area

Details
Category: Latest Business Alerts

Ethiopia to be part of the free trade zone

African trade officials met this week in Johannesburg to launch negotiations for a free trade area (FTA) which would embrace more than 26 countries, and about a trillion dollars of economic output.

The proposed deal would unite three existing trade blocs in central, eastern and southern Africa. It is believed that the free trade area will do away with most trade barriers between participating countries. African leaders said that the Free Trade Area (FTA) would be practical within three years.

Two of the blocs, the Common Market for East and Southern Africa (COMESA) and the East African Community (EAC), have already been enjoying tariff- and quota-free trade.

In the mean time, the third bloc, the Southern Africa Development Community (SADC), only has levies on 15 percent of goods and should be removing those by January.

When the negotiations are concluded, the enlarged FTA would include Ethiopia, Angola, Botswana, Burundi, Comoros, Djibouti, DRC, Egypt, Eritrea, Kenya, Lesotho, Libya, Madagascar, Malawi, Mauritius, Mozambique, Namibia, Rwanda, Seychelles, South Africa, Sudan, Swaziland, Tanzania, Uganda, Zambia and Zimbabwe.

Commerce within Africa is limited with not more than 10 percent of the continent's trade being conducted between African countries, while the balance goes overseas.
After its formation is complete, the free trade area will be hopefully open to regions throughout the whole continent, Diouf of the African Agency for Trade and Development said.

Source: Christian Science Monitor, Reuters

Leather Exports Raise $11.7 million in June

Details
Category: Latest Business Alerts

Leather exports from Ethiopia earned 11.7 Million US Dollars in revenue in the month of June according to the Ethiopian Leather Technology Development Institute.

The revenue was earned through the export of products that include finished leather good such as shoes and gloves noted Birhanu Sirjabo, Director of communications with the Institute.

The amount earned in the month is 4 million US dollars more than what was earned in the month of May he claimed.
